Problem 1: A new capital budgeting project is being considered. The project will reduce expenses increase earnings by $5,000 annually and (revenue) before depreciation and taxes by $45,504 annually. The project will generate $8,000 per year in depreciation of the required equipment. The firm's marginal tax rate is 40 percent. What is the project's after-tax operating cash flows (OCF)?
